In most cases, the transcription factors in eukaryotes which bind to promoter or enhancer sequences are activator proteins which induce transcription. That proteins generally have at least two distinct domains of protein structure, a DNA- binding domain which identify the specific DNA sequence to bind to and an activation domain responsible for bringing about the transcriptional activation by interaction with other transcription factors and the RNA polymerase molecule. Various transcription factors operate as dimers, either homodimers (identical subunits) or heterodimers (dissimilar subunits) with the subunits held together through dimerization domains. The DNA dimerization domains and binding domains have characteristic protein structures (motifs) which are explained
